Whitehall-Coplay board confirms operational director and introduces new assistant principal

Whitehall-Coplay School District Board of School Directors · November 24, 2025

The board approved Mister Dillard as operational director of educational operations, reassigned Mister Ryle to Zephyr, and heard brief remarks from the newly introduced assistant principal, who self-identified as Meg Pierre.

Superintendent Mister Shiffert announced the board’s approval of Mister Dillard as the district’s new operational director of educational operations and said Mister Ryle will move into a role at Zephyr. The superintendent praised both appointees for their work and commitment to the district.

Doctor Mays introduced the new assistant principal, using the name "Meg Kiher." The new administrator addressed the board and the public, saying, "I'm really excited, to be coming back home for me," and expressing gratitude for the opportunity to serve the district. Notably, the transcript contains both the introducer’s use of the name "Meg Kiher" and the administrator’s self-introduction as "Meg Pierre." The board invited the new assistant principal to meet members after the meeting.

The personnel approvals for these administrative changes were reflected in the personnel agenda vote earlier in the meeting. The board offered congratulations and thanks to outgoing and incoming staff and moved on to other items.
